...Atlantic Monthly has made an inquiry of ten thousand teachers and superintendents of public schools concerning the actual status of teachers and the schools in every part of the Union. The replies from the best informed men in the work in every state give at firsthand information that contains much encouragement, but much discouragement also. The excessive size of classes, the instability of great masses of teachers, the insecurity of their positions, in some communities the petty political and religious interference-these "confessions" are startling and shocking. Fifty-four thousand dollars was spent at Yale last year on athletics. Of this amount, $10,000 was subscribed by the undergraduates and the remainder was raised chiefly by the proceeds of baseball and football games...
